Cliffs of Moher Tour from Dublin with Boat Cruise
With summer weather within reach, our Cliffs of Moher & Boat Cruise tour is a popular choice.
Enjoy a late start at 10:00 from College Green in central Dublin!
In early- afternoon, upon arrival on the west coast you'll enjoy time for lunch in the tiny village of Liscannor.
Afterwards, we'll proceed to nearby Doolin, where the most modern local sailing fleet is ready to take you on an exciting, relaxing cruise out into the bay to see Cliffs of Moher from the water.
The tour will reassemble dockside at Doolin Pier by mid- afternoon for the return journey to Dublin. Your driver will take a scenic route along part of the Wild Atlantic Way back to reach the capital in good time for refreshments and dinner arrangements.
The tour drops right downtown by 19:30 approx - leaving ample time this evening to freshen up and enjoy all of the wonderful restaurant and pub options the Temple Bar and Grafton Street districts have to offer.

Guinness Storehouse Experience
Welcome to the Home of Guinness. Located in the heart of St. James’s Gate, the Guinness Storehouse was once the old fermentation plant of the brewery where today, you can experience the history, heart, and soul of Ireland’s most iconic beer. As you explore the space, find out what makes the brewing process so special, hear about the history of the brewery and check out the archive of award-winning Guinness advertisements on display. Your final stop is the Gravity Bar, where you can enjoy the perfectly poured, perfectly chilled pint of Guinness included in your ticket with panoramic views of Dublin city and beyond.
Ireland's Eye and Howth Coastal Boat Tour
This tour explores the treasures of Ireland's Eye, Howth Harbour and Cliffs, and Dublin Bay. Take a trip around Ireland's Eye, taking in spectacular views of the Island, the Martello Tower, and the colony of seals and birds, including Puffins and Guillemots, which inhabit the area in Dublin Bay Biosphere. Get up close and personal with the flora and fauna on Ireland's Eye. The island is a Nature Reserve and a sanctuary for wildlife. Commentary by our expert captains on the history of the island, the wildlife, and the famous Kirwan murder on the island is provided. Plenty of photo opportunities.

Gravedigger 2-Hour Ghost Bus Tour From Dublin
Dive into the spine-tingling Gravedigger Ghost Bus Tour, a unique 4D journey through Dublin's darkest corners.
Starting at Trinity College, our costumed guides will transport you back 600 years, unveiling a city besieged by plague and shadowed in eerie legends.
Experience the chill of the "haunted" Audeon's Catholic Church, and the solemnity of Kilmainham Prison, a site of profound tragedies.
Discover a centuries-old cemetery, the silent witness to countless stories, including those of the notorious body snatchers.
This tour is not just a trip; it's a full immersion into the macabre history and mysteries of Dublin, promising an unforgettable experience for those daring to explore the supernatural side of the city, entertain yourself, and have a laugh with this amazing tour.
